A client tells the nurse that attending church school on Sundays and learning about those who were influenced by Jesus and God is an important aspect of the client's life

From this information, the nurse determines that the client is at which spiritual developmental stage?
1. Adolescence.
2. Young adulthood.
3. 7–12 years old.
4. Mid-adulthood.


Correct Answer: 3
Rationale 1: In adolescence, experience of the world is beyond the family unit, and spiritual beliefs can aid understanding of extended environment. There is a general conformity to the beliefs of those around the adolescent.
Rationale 2: In young adulthood, the individual forms independent commitments, lifestyle, beliefs, and attitudes, and begins to develop personal meaning for symbols of religion and faith.
Rationale 3: From 7 to 12, the client attempts to sort fantasy from fact by demanding proofs or demonstrations of reality. Stories are important for finding meaning and organizing experience. Stories and beliefs are accepted literally.
Rationale 4: In mid-adulthood, there are attempts to reconcile contradictions in mind and experience, and to remain open to others' truths.
